what is 8q= 96 what is it?

Respuesta :

EyoelG752425 EyoelG752425
  • 03-11-2022

To find the value of q, divide both sides of the equation by 8:

[tex]\begin{gathered} 8q=96 \\ \Rightarrow\frac{8q}{8}=\frac{96}{8} \end{gathered}[/tex]

Simplify both members of the equation:

[tex]\begin{gathered} \Rightarrow q=\frac{96}{8} \\ \Rightarrow q=12 \end{gathered}[/tex]

Therefore:

[tex]q=12[/tex]
